Approximate entropy as indication of goodness-of-fit
2000Publisher Summary This chapter provides information on the approximate entropy, approximate entropy (ApEn), as indication of goodness-of-fit criterion. ApEn is a measure of the regularity or orderliness of a sequence of numbers. It calibrates sequential relationships, between the numbers, in terms of the randomness of the numbers.

Approximate entropy (ApEn) as a complexity measure
Chaos: An Interdisciplinary Journal of Nonlinear Science, 1995Approximate entropy (ApEn) is a recently developed statistic quantifying regularity and complexity, which appears to have potential application to a wide variety of relatively short (greater than 100 points) and noisy time-series data. The development of ApEn was motivated by data length constraints commonly encountered, e.g., in heart rate, EEG, and ...

Approximation and relative entropy
2012We re-visit the notion of Approximate Confinement in terms of information theory. This notion formalises probabilistic non-interference in terms of process indistinguishability. We show that it corresponds to the notion of relative entropy, aka Kullback-Leibler divergence.
